Job Details:

The Fraud and Applications Support Analyst is responsible for providing second line technical support to multiple customers across various regions. They will work across 20+ custom-built and standard applications and database systems programmed with a variety of languages on multiple operating systems. The Fraud and Applications Support Analyst is also responsible for operating various prevention schemes to identify and reduce fraud.

Essential

Provide application support including system administration, technical troubleshooting, root cause analysis, incident resolution and where required, escalation.

Provide second line technical support to the wider business including Back Office (Unix, Wintel) and IT (Oracle, MS SQL) and give advice from the application perspective in order to resolve any identified problems.

Develop fraud reports, designed to identify instances of fraud.

Administer the daily fraud checklists. Review and analyse transactions to identify any cases of actual or suspected fraud.

Fully investigate any cases of actual or potential fraud.

Regularly review existing solutions and propose new solutions to improve processes to minimise the risk of fraud.

Liaise with other teams and external customers to prevent/capture fraud and administer hotlists.

Regularly review and where necessary amend support documents, ensuring they are up to date, comprehensible and available to other team members

Prepare service level agreement (SLA) reports on production services. This includes performance data collection, coordinating problem management system outputs, producing graphs as required for inclusion in the four weekly service reports

Comply with Cubic’s values and adherence to all company policy and procedures. In particular comply with the code of conduct, quality, security and occupational health, safety and environmental policies and procedures.

Skills knowledge and experience:

Essential

Solid experience of relational database management systems (RDBMS) (i.e. Oracle or MS SQL)

Experience of small to large scale transactional systems within a fraud/application support role

Competent user of MS, specifically Excel, Access, Outlook and Word

Experience of working with sensitive/confidential information

Experience of working with remote teams

Desirable

Experience of Unix shell scripting, .Net, C#, ASP.Net programming

Experience of working as part of a 24/7 support team

Knowledge of ITSO smart ticketing

Knowledge of the Payment Card Industry (PCI) Data Security Standard (DSS) regulations

Experience of working in a fraud prevention/fraud analysis role

Good understanding of payment processing and fraud prevention processes

Experience of working in a DevOps role/environment

Essential

BA/BSc in IT or other related discipline or equivalent experience

Desirable

ITIL foundation or higher
